Prior to Move, Michele spent 10 years at Tribune Company. During that time, Michele's role expanded from finance to business development where she conceived and executed on new products and strategies through partnerships, licensing, joint ventures and internal product development for Tribune Interactive, Tribune Company's $250M internet business operating 40+ newspaper, television and niche websites and invested in properties such as CareerBuilder.com, Apartments.com, HomeFinder.com, ShopLocal.com and metromix.com. Michele began her career in public accounting. She holds an MBA from Northwestern University's Kellogg School of Management and a Bachelor's degree in accounting from Indiana University.
The Entrepreneur-in-Residence Program provides Kellogg students with the opportunity to receive guidance from and network with entrepreneurs, angel investors, and venture capitalists. Students may register for a 30-minute appointment with the EIR through Campus Groups.
